CVE-2020-35226: NETGEAR JGS516PE/GS116Ev2 v2.6.0.43 devices allow unauthenticated users to modify the switch DHCP configura...

NETGEAR JGS516PE/GS116Ev2 v2.6.0.43 devices allow unauthenticated users to modify the switch DHCP configuration by sending the corresponding write request command.

Plain-English summary

Certain NETGEAR ProSAFE Plus JGS516PE and GS116Ev2 switches running v2.6.0.43 can let unauthenticated users change DHCP configuration. For a business, this could disrupt switch management or network operations if an exposed management interface is reachable by untrusted users.

Executive priority

Treat as a targeted network-infrastructure risk. Prioritize environments using the named NETGEAR switches, especially if management access is broadly reachable. Urgency is hard to quantify because severity and exploitation evidence are incomplete.

Mitigation direction

  • Identify JGS516PE and GS116Ev2 switches running firmware v2.6.0.43.
  • Check NETGEAR support or advisory guidance for fixed firmware or approved mitigation.
  • Restrict switch management access to trusted administrative networks only.
  • Remove internet or guest-network reachability to switch management interfaces.
  • Monitor DHCP configuration changes on affected switches.

Validation and detection

  • Inventory switch model and firmware version from approved management records.
  • Confirm whether management interfaces are reachable from untrusted networks.
  • Review recent switch DHCP configuration changes for unauthorized modifications.
  • Check vendor guidance before applying firmware or configuration changes.
